12、osition your hand and adjust the strap until the fi t is snug and comfortable. batteries (supplied or optionally available) you can use the following batteries with this cd-player: alkaline batteries type AAA (LR03, UM4) or r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ery. notes:old and new or different types of

13、batteries should not be combined. remove batteries if they are empty or if the player is not going to be used for a long time. inserting batteries 1push to open the cd door 2open the cd compartment and insert 2 x AAA batteries. battery indication the approximate power level of your batteries is show

14、n in the display.(on remote control) battery full battery two-thirds full battery one-third full battery dead or empty. when the batteries are dead or empty, the symbol fl ashes, is displayed, and the beep tone sounds repeatedly. indicator lights up orange and beeps briefl y. indicator then turns re

15、d before player switches off. average playing time of batteries under normal conditions battery typeesp + power save normal AAA3 hours alkaline AAA12 hours r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ery10 hours batteries contain chemical substances, so they should be disposed of properly. caution use of control

16、s or adjustments or performance of procedures other than herein may result in hazardous radiation exposure or other unsafe operation. this set complies with the radio interference requirements of the European Community. the model and serial numbers are located inside the cd door. 17、 1-4 power supply / general information ECO-PLUS NiMH battery information (for versions supplied with the r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ery AY 3363) recharging works only on players supplied with the r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ery AY 3363. recharging the ECO-PLUS NiMH battery on board 1insert t

18、he r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ery AY 3363. 2connect the mains adapter to the DC socket of the player and then to the wall socket. yis pulsing. recharging stops after a maximum of 7 hours, or when you start playback. 3when the battery is fully recharged, appears in the display. notes: it is norma

19、l for the batteries to become warm during recharging. if the batteries become too warm, recharging will be interrupted for approximately 30 minutes andis displayed. to ensure proper recharging on board, take care that contacts are clean. use only the ECO-PLUS NiMH battery AY 3363. handling instructi

20、ons recharging already charged or half-charged batteries will shorten their lifetime. we therefore recommend that you let the rechargeable ECO-PLUS NiMH battery run till it is completely empty before you recharge it. to avoid a short circuit, do not let the battery touch any metal object. if the bat

21、tery becomes empty soon after recharging, then either its contacts are dirty or it has reached the end of its lifetime. mains adapter (supplied or optionally available) use only the AY 3170 power adapter supplied with your product (4.5 V / 300 mA direct current, positive pole to the centre pin). any

22、 other product may damage the player. 1make sure the local voltage corresponds to the adapters voltage. 2connect the adapter to the DC socket of the player and to the wall socket. note: always disconnect the adapter when you are not using it. environmental information all redundant packing material

23、has been omitted. we have done our utmost to make the packaging easily separable into two mono materials: cardboard and polyethylene. your set consists of materials which can be recycled if disassembled by a specialized company. please observe the local regulations regarding the disposal of packing

24、materials, exhausted batteries and old equipment. headphones HJ050 connect the supplied headphones to the p socket of the player. note:pcan also be used for connecting this set to your hifi i system to adjust the sound and volume, use the controls on the connected audio equipment and on the cd playe

38、 you open the cd lid. while the cd is read, 1 -:- fl ashes in the display. volume and bass volume adjustment adjust the volume by using +/ (+/ (vol). bass adjustment press eq (on the set only) to switch the bass enhancement on or off ydbb is shown if the bass enhancement is activated. features selec

39、ting a track and searching selecting a track during playback briefl y press 5 or 6 once or several times to skip to the current, previous or next track. yplayback continues with the selected track, and the tracks number is displayed. selecting a track when playback is stopped 1 briefl y press 5 or 6

40、 once or several times to select the desired track. the track number is displayed. 2press 2; to start cd play. yplayback starts with the selected track. searching for a passage during playback 1 keep 5 or 6 pressed to fi nd a particular passage in a backward or forward direction. ysearching starts w

41、hile playback continues at low volume. after 2 seconds the search speeds up. 2release the button when you reach the desired passage. yplayback continues from this position. notes: if the player is in mode (see mode chapter), searching is not possible. in shuffl e, shuffl e repeat or repeat mode (see

42、 mode chapter), searching is only possible within the particular track. selecting different playing possibilities-mode it is possible to play tracks in random order, to repeat a single track or the entire cd, and to play the fi rst few seconds of each track. 1press mode during playback as often as r

43、equired in order to activate one of the following modes. the active mode is shown in the display. yshuffl e : all tracks of the cd are played in random order until all of them have been played once. yshuffl e repeat: all tracks of the cd are played repeatedly in random order. yrepeat: the entire cd

44、is played repeatedly. y : the fi rst 10 seconds of each of the remaining tracks are played in sequence. 2 playback starts in the chosen mode after 2 seconds. to return to normal playback, press mode repeatedly until the display shows no active modes.
